I applied online. The process took 1 week. I interviewed at Noom (Grand Rapids, MI) in Mar 2018
Interview
About 5 days after applying I was asked about availability for a 3-hour interview. I had a 3 step interview process that I completed in just one day.
1. Phone interview with general questions
2. Mock coaching exercise that lasted about one hour. The "client" wanted to lose 20 pounds but didn't want to change anything so it was very stressful. This part definitely puts your coaching skills to the test.
3. Zoom meeting with the team manager. She asked very specific questions about health coaching. She gave me different cases and I had to tell her how I would coach that person... Lasted about one hour.
I was not offered the job and/or given any feedback so I am not sure what went wrong. I am bilingual and a certified lifestyle coach for the NDPP program. I also have extensive medical education and clinical experience... Maybe I was overqualified, lol!
At least they didn't waste much of my time in between steps...
After submitting a self-recorded video introducing yourself, if accepted, you are invited to a video interview. The conversation explores your background, education and experience, as well as goals for your career. It was relaxed but professional.

A few rounds of interviews with leadership and then presented with a case study for a theoretical user of Noom of how to assist them through menu selection at a popular restaurant chain.
Interview process included a mock interview (digital) and a virtual 1:1 meeting with a Heath Coach. My 1:1 meeting ended up being a phone call rather than a virtual meeting.

Virtual Health Coach applicants have rated the interview process at Noom with 3 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ty) and assessed their interview experience as 69% positive. To compare, the company-average is 58.5% positive. This is according to Glassdoor user ratings.
Candidates applying for Virtual Health Coach roles take an average of 20 days to get hired, when considering 263 user submitted interviews for this role. To compare, the hiring process at Noom overall takes an average of 20 days.
Common stages of the interview process at Noom as a Virtual Health Coach according to 263 Glassdoor interviews include:
One on one interview: 26%
Presentation: 24%
Phone interview: 21%
Other: 11%
IQ intelligence test: 7%
Background check: 4%
Skills test: 2%
Drug test: 2%
Personality test: 2%
Group panel interview: 1%
